DuPont allowed 100% stake in Indian arm
The Foreign Investment Promotion Board has allowed EI DuPont to retain 100% stake in its Indian subsidiary by granting an exemption from the disinvestment clause of the original approval.

IRA norms on cost containment likely
The Insurance Regulatory Authority (IRA) is planning to establish a set of cost containment guidelines for the insurance industry.

Air India restricts upgradation
In order to contain its losses, Air India has restricted upgradation of passengers on all its flights following a board meeting last fortnight.
